solution is (x, y ) → (- 1, 4 )
y + 2x = 2 → (1)
y + 4x = 0 → (2)
subtract equation (1) from (2) to eliminate term in y
(y - y ) + (4x - 2x ) = (0 - 2 )
2x = - 2 ( divide both sides by 2 )
x = - 1
substitute x = - 1 in either (1) or (2) and solve for y
(1) → y - 2 = 2 ( add 2 to both sides )
y = 4
solution is (x, y ) → (- 1, 4 )
Answer:
12 m²
Step-by-step explanation:
Area of the floor:
area = length * width
area = 4 m * 5 m
area = 20 m²
area of carpet = 60% of area of the floor
area of carpet = 0.6 * 20 m²
area of carpet = 12 m²
